Hex Cougar spearheads the hybrid trap 2025 takeover with his "Embody" EP, a five-shot rifle with an unexpected amount of power behind it.

The good: With a big focus on big, driving leads that push through the track's soundscapes, "Embody" is certainly memorable and impactful. Whether it's the heavier, bassier mixes of "Eyes" and "Dream Of U", or the more emotive and melodic cuts like "Still In Love" or "Ultra", Hex Cougar is consistent in his delivery of quality hybrid trap.

The bad: Aside from "Oxytocin" being the ugly duckling for me, something about "Embody" just doesn't feel as immersive as it could be. This is an EP created to feel good, but it still feels somewhat restrained in places. A good showing from Hex Cougar, though.


Name Comments Superlative
Ultra Strong, hardwave-influenced bass hits with a twinge of emotion and a very nice break underlying it all Melodic
Eyes A longer, more thoughtful intro that builds to an unexpectedly hard-hitting drop section with a big snare Standout
Oxytocin Prominent melody that sounds almost screechy in practice, perhaps a bit too much for my liking Intense
Still In Love Overstimulation packed into a future garage tune, with shimmering vocal chops and a meaty bassline Upbeat
Dream Of U Screechy, heavy, acidic, and packs a punch — superbly executed explosive finisher for this EP Switchup
